2.2 Properties of Water

Hydrogen bonds are responsible for unique chemical properties.

• Chemical properties:– cohesion

- sticks to itself

– adhesion- sticks to other

things

– versatile solvent- “universal”

2.2 Properties of Water

Hydrogen bonds are responsible for unique properties:

• Physical properties:– States:

- liquid, gas

- Solid – ice formation

- Floatation!

– Specific heat- stays cool, hot

- stores energy

- moderates temperature

- boiling, freezing

– Surface tension- elastic (next slide)!

- capillary action
